## How a Lubbock engagement usually goes

I like to keep things pretty transparent, so here's a typical roadmap for how I work with businesses in Lubbock:

1. **Initial Chat & Discovery (1-2 weeks):** We start with a free 20-minute call, then if it feels like a fit, I'll dive a bit deeper into your current processes. I'll ask a lot of questions to really understand your challenges and identify potential areas where AI could help. This isn't just a sales pitch; it's me trying to understand your world. 2. **Solution Design & Proposal (1-2 weeks):** Based on our discovery, I put together a clear, focused proposal outlining the specific AI solution I recommend, what it will do, and how we'll measure success. I'll include a fixed-fee quote for the project at this stage. No surprises. 3. **Development & Implementation (4-8 weeks, project dependent):** Once we agree on the plan, I get to work building and implementing the solution. I'll keep you updated regularly and involve you in key decisions. My goal is to integrate the AI smoothly into your existing operations with minimal disruption. 4. **Testing, Training & Handover (1-2 weeks):** Before wrapping up, we rigorously test the new system to make sure it's doing what it's supposed to do. I'll also make sure you and your team are comfortable using it. My aim is for you to be fully self-sufficient, but I'm always available for follow-up support.
